Subject: bug#3003: 23.0.92; Point trapped in overlay

Hi Emacs Developers,

I thought this was an org bug but it turns out an Emacs one. See the
discussion thread in: http://thread.gmane.org/gmane.emacs.orgmode/12885.

Here is how to reproduce.

1. Make an overlay
   Org mode is used only to easily create such an overlay that could
   demonstrate the bug.

   -  In a new buffer in org mode, begin a line with a few spaces and
      then type in http://www.google.com

   -  Move the cursor to be within that url and type 'C-c C-l' and follow
      the minibufer prompt to change the 'description' to 'google'

2. Put the point to the left of the url overlay and try move the cursor
   into the overlay. You can see when it reaches the first character of
   the overlay, it appears stuck.

Daniel Clemente in http://article.gmane.org/gmane.emacs.orgmode/12887
analysed the cause.
